Lucy, March, 2000
Lucy had been wandering for at least three weeks in cold March weather near Decatur, Illinois, when a
kindly rescuer took her in. Lucy was sweet-tempered and well-trained; obviously she had once belonged to someone, but attempts to find her owner were fruitless. Her rescuer took her to the vet and
Lucy was found to be heartworm-positive. It was also thought that Lucy had been used for breeding; it appeared she'd had several litters of puppies.
The rescuer contacted LABMED and we were happy to help. Lucy's new vet helped, too, by offering a rescue
discount to help cover the cost of the treatment. Lucy has had her treatment and recovered fully. Her rescuer and family fell so in love with her that they decided to adopt her and she is now
enjoying life with an active, loving family. They think Lucy might make a wonderful therapy dog and are looking into training her for this work.
